I live in Gdańsk ( Danzig ) since i was born. What can i say , beautiful city, wonderful old town, not so beautiful like before the war but it still worth seeing. How long you intend to stay ? in order to do realy good tour in gdańsk it is necessary to have at least 3 - 4 days . Unfortunetly there is no possibility to shoot MG-42 in Gdańsk , AK-47 , P08 are available.


If you want to move by car, unfortunately we have huge traffic jams at the moment due to road works in whole city.

Yes we have trams , and city trains system they work quite efficiently . In shooting ranges it is necessary to ask for bookings a week in advance .

kal.9 mm PARA - pistols : Glock 17, Glock 19, H&K USP Expert, Mag 98,
kal.9 mm Makarov - P-83, machine pistol PM 63 - Rak,
kal..357 Magnum - revolver Rossi,
kal.7,62x39 - assault gun AK 47 Kałasznikow ,
kal.7,62x25 - pistols : TT, CZ 52,
kal.12/70 - shotguns : Bock Iż 27, Mossberg

Offer of one of shooting ranges .


Unfortunately in surroundings of Gdańsk reenactments are very occasionally :x in the near future there is nothing.
